Cardan Joint

Universal joints allow travel shafts to move along with the suspension while the shaft is usually moving so power can be transmitted when the drive shaft isn’t in a direct line between the Cardan Joint china transmission and travel wheels.

Rear-wheel-drive vehicles include universal joints (or U-joints) at both ends of the travel shaft. U-joints connect to yokes that also allow travel shafts to move fore and aft as automobiles go over bumps or dips in the street, which properly shortens or lengthens the shaft.

Front-drive vehicles also use two joints, called constant velocity (or CV) joints, nonetheless they are a diverse kind that also compensate for steering changes.

On rear-travel vehicles, one indication of a donned U-join is a “clank” sound when a drive gear is engaged. On front-drive vehicles, CV joints typically make a clicking noises when they’re worn. CV joints are covered by protective rubber shoes, and if the shoes or boots crack or are normally damaged, the CV joints will lose their lubrication and become broken by dirt and moisture.
cardan couplings will be elastic, double-jointed result couplings used to pay for primary suspension misalignments in the bogie with full torque transmission between the gear unit and the powered wheel collection shaft. They permit large shaft displacements and invite major misalignments between the axle and the apparatus unit while creating only very slight response forces.
coupling parts can be installed individually on the gear product and wheel established shaft. The coupling parts include pre-installed self-calibrated spherical bearings with shielded rubber elements. These have an extended service life as high as one million kilometers of car travel and leisure. By screwing the brackets onto the spherical bearing pins, the coupling could be installed simply using standard tools. The spacer quickly centers itself.
